FSHD Connect Conference

Empowering You through Connection and Education

The FSHD Society’s Connect Conference is the world’s largest gathering for individuals and families affected by Facioscapulohumeral muscular dystrophy (FSHD). Held every two years, the FSHD Connect Conference brings together hundreds of individuals and families living with FSHD, clinicians, and researchers for two days of immersive learning and workshops.
